Maoists kidnap security guards in raid on private firmSeptember 2nd, 2009 PATNA - Suspected Maoist guerrillas in Bihar have kidnapped six security guards working for a private construction company that had not met their extortion demand, police here said Wednesday. The incident took place late Tuesday when a group of armed guerrillas attacked the office of Subhash Projects & Marketing Ltd (SPML), a private road construction firm in Jamui district.

Maoists blow up railway station in OrissaAugust 25th, 2009 SUNDARGARH - Maoists blew up a railway station and abducted three railway employees in Orissa's Sundargarh district on Tuesday morning. According to the police, about 20 left-wing ultras blew up Roxy railway station, located in a remote area under K Bolang police station and triggered the explosion after asking the employees to move out.

Maoists blow up school building in BiharJune 16th, 2009 GAYA - In a fresh case of Maoist violence in Bihar, rebels triggered dynamite blasts in a government school building at Chakarbandha village in Gaya district on Monday. Two more buildings in the vicinity of the school, housing the village community hall and the village administration office were also damaged in the blast.
Combing operations in Bihar after five poll staff killedApril 24th, 2009 PATNA - The Bihar Police along with paramilitary forces launched combing operations early Friday after five poll personnel including four security men were killed in Bihar's Muzaffarpur district when suspected Maoists triggered a landmine blast Thursday night. Five poll personnel including four security men were killed in the landmine blast Thursday night near Mohammaddpur village under Deoria police station in Muzaffarpur district, about 70 km from here, when they were returning from the polling station, police said.

Ten prisoners escape as Maoists attack Bihar courtJanuary 15th, 2009 PATNA - Suspected Maoists Friday attacked a court in Bihar's Jamui district, leading to the escape of 10 under-trials including two Maoist activists, the police said. A group of armed Maoists attacked a police escort Friday evening in the Jamui court premises when over three dozen under-trial prisoners were being taken back to jail after hearing in the court, the police said.
Maoists attack train in Bihar, policeman killedDecember 24th, 2008 PATNA - Suspected Maoists Thursday attacked a passenger train in Bihar, killing a policeman and injuring two others and escaping with some arms and ammunitions, officials said. Government Railway Police (GRP) sources said a group of Maoists attacked Muzaffarpur-Bhagalpur intercity train near Bariyarpur in Lakhisarai district, about 150 km from here.
